Hurricane Hannah's could be a little closer than the Marketplace since the refill station is right next to the sidewalk to Epcot. Otherwise you would walk into the lobby on the BC and turn right. The Marketplace is just past the elevators. I would guess that 4 to 5 minutes from the time you exit the YC would do it.![]()

Timing estimates
Walk to front of park- 25 min
wait for monorail- 5 min
monorail ride/switch to express mono at TTC/arrive at gates- 15 min?
Walk to BC bus stop from Germany- 25 min
Wait for bus- 10 min
Ride to MK- 15 min
If I was already in EPCOT, I would walk to the front and take the monorail- (it is TOO a ride!).
